*NETHERLANDS VS UNITED STATES OF AMERICA MATCH 10-PREVIEW: ICC WORLD CUP QUALIFIERS 2023*

*THE BUILD UP:*

Barring the Windies game for USA, both these sides have experienced what annihilation feels like. Zimbabwe smoked Netherlands the other day with Raza storm taking place at Harare. They could never really make a comeback in the second innings despite registering a mammoth total of 315 in the first. Such a morale deflating defeat often goes onto ask the question: “Are we really good enough?”. But Holland shouldn’t worry as much specially with USA being on the other hand. Their batting was supreme and was calculative. That aspect of their game holding control will give them the confidence heading into this fixture, searching for pride and for a much needed win. 

USA, however will need to wrap up their knuckles now. They have lost two in a row and their last loss against Nepal with the Nepali boys chasing it with 7 overs to spare, in no way, gives them any kind of confidence. Their batting stocks have gone down and they have been at best, substandard. With these pitches producing decent ODI scores, the batters from UAE need to bring their A game to the table and starting from tomorrow, could probably be the best time to do so. 

*NETHERLANDS PROBABLE XI:*

Vikramjit Singh, Max O’Dowd, Wesley Barresi, Bas de Leede, Teja Nidamanuru, Scott Edwards (c & wk), Saqib Zulfiqar, Shariz Ahmed, Logan van Beek, Aryan Dutt, Clayton Floyd.

Edwards and Vikram will have to adorn the role of the team’s reliable bets once again. They were classy even the other day when Netherlands went past the 300 run mark and will have to show what they have in store to beat USA, who hold the ability to surprise oppositions at times and an upset may well be due. With a belter of a surface expected, these two would require plenty of support from Netherlands’ middle order and the other opener in Max. They should target a total of 350 on this batting paradise so that a batting masterclass like this, rules out USA from the reckoning only. 

Eagerly looking forward to how Netherlands improve their bowling performance. In their opening encounter, which ended in a big loss, the men in orange were met with a Raza carnage and all their hopes went down the drain. Claytan Floyd and the part timer Vikramjit were the only two bright prospects for Ned in their opener, a sight which no team would like to have. What made it worse was how badly the premier bowlers were treated. I expect a better showing from Shariz and Aryan come tomorrow. 

*USA PROBABLE XI:*

Steven Taylor, Sushant Modani, Aaron Jones (c), Saiteja Mukkamalla, Gajanand Singh, Shayan Jahangir (wk), Nisarg Patel, Jasdeep Singh, Nosthush Kenjige, Kyle Phillip, Saurabh Netravalkar 

We have seen two valiant and powerpacked knocks going in vain from two USA batters over the course of their two games in this beautiful tournament. The first one was from Gajanand Anand and the second one was from Shayan Jahangir, both batting in the middle order, fighting hard in the middle but faking way too short. It’s been a case of their batters not clicking the way USA fans would have expected. Even two or three impactful performances in the form of partnerships can set the tone and this is exactly what has been a lacking factor for USA. If they bat first, they should look to give space to an anchor, play sensibly for a majority of the innings only to go bonkers in the last 15. This pitch, expected to remain a beauty, will make sure that their plan succeeds. 

The Duo of Noshtush and Jessy Singh were formidable with the bowl, bowling tight lines and hardly leaking anything. Both their economies under 5, reflect this piece of information. Excited to see what they have in store come tomorrow vs Netherlands.
